Exploring The Art of Loose Leaf
Moving beyond boxed tea bags, the burgeoning world of loose leaf tea offers a truly rich experience. Forget the dust and fannings often found in tea bags; loose leaf delivers whole leaves, allowing for a greater release of scent and taste. The process itself can be transformed into a mindful ritual - carefully measuring your leaves, enjoying the unfolding of the leaves as they steep, and observing the created brew. From delicate green varieties to robust black blends, each loose leaf offers a unique personality waiting to be discovered. Many enthusiasts appreciate the ability to adjust the steeping time and amount of leaves for a perfectly personalized cup. It’s not just about drinking tea; it's about appreciating the whole journey.

Delving into Looseleaf Tea
Many tea lovers are increasingly learning about the advantages of looseleaf tea. Unlike dusty tea bags, which often contain small pieces of tea leaves, looseleaf tea features whole or gently cut foliage. This careful processing maintains more of the tea's original flavors and essential oils, resulting in a richer, more nuanced brew. Furthermore, the larger leaf size generally indicates a higher quality of tea, promising a more enjoyable ritual.
